LFS Executive Summary – Hawaii

Over one hundred sixty-five thousand (165,000) students in two hundred and seventy-nine schools in Hawaii will benefit from the Local Food to Schools co-operative grant. This grant project links three USDA programs “The Local Food for Schools Cooperative program” (LFS), “Bringing the Farm to School Producer Training” (BTFP), and the “Team Nutrition School Meal Recipe Development Project “(TNR).

Pascua Yaqui Tribe

The Pascua Yaqui Tribe Local Food Purchase Assistance Program is designed to support expanded food consumption among low-income individuals and families enrolled in one of three programs operated by Pascua Yaqui Tribe in Tucson, Arizona. All processes and activities are directed toward four primary goals. One is to create and expand economic opportunity for socially/historically socially disadvantaged food producers, of which, outreach has identified approximately 15 producers we intend to choose seven or eight from.
